Electricity Prices in Electra, TX
Residential Electricity Rates in Electra
Residential electricity prices in Electra, TX in March 2026 averaged approximately 16.39 cents per kilowatthour (¢/kWh), which was about 13% less than the national average rate of 18.83 ¢/kWh (March 2026). [1]

On a year-over-year basis - from February 2025 to February 2026 - residential electricity prices in Electra increased approximately 4%, from 14.88 ¢/kWh to 15.41 ¢/kWh. [1]

On a year-over-year basis, residential natural gas prices in Electra (Texas) increased approximately 32%, from 14.22 $/Mcf (February 2025) to 18.74 $/Mcf (February 2026). [2]

About Electra
The city of Electra, TX in Wichita County has an approximate population of 2,791. [4]
